Illinois state senator’s bill seeks to claw back 163 million USD lost to crypto fraud

The Illinois Senate Executive Committee passed Senate Bill 1797, targeting regulation of digital asset businesses. Senator Mark Walker highlighted the 163 million USD lost to crypto fraud in 2023, stating the necessity for credible standards in the industry.

The bill designates the Illinois Department of Financial and Professional Regulation as the regulatory authority. Companies will need to comply with registration requirements and implement customer asset protection measures.
